Dining Out Can Be A Healthier Affair

Dining out can still have a place in your healthy lifestyle!

There’s not much that can beat a nutritious home-cooked meal. However, you may not always have the time (or patience) to prepare and pack your meals the night before. While outside dining does present its own share of challenges to the health-conscious, good nutrition can still be achieved. It all boils down to keeping a few key guidelines in mind and knowing where/when to apply them.
